
Celine’s Story
Celine is a Romanian 17-year old living in Northern Ireland. She’s lived most of her life as a migrant, first in Norway, where she spent nearly seven years, and now in Northern Ireland. She studies for her A levels in English Literature, Government and Politics, and Sociology. All those subjects align with her deep sense of justice and equity. She dreams of becoming a human rights lawyer, driven by a desire to stand up for others and to speak up for those unheard. Even though she lives with deafness, this has only strengthened her desire to advocate for others and bridge divides between people. She’s determined to have her voice heard despite her deafness and not to let it limit her ambitions. Instead, it has fuelled her passion to ensure that all voices should be valued and that no one is left out or overlooked.
